#980c02 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#980c02 is composed of 59.6% red, 4.7%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 92.1% magenta, 98.7%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 4 degrees, a saturation of 97.4% and a lightness of 30.2%. #980c02 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ff1804 with #310000. Closest websafe color is: #990000.

#980c02 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#980c02 has RGB values of R:152, G:12,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.92, Y:0.99,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 9964546.
